Transaction 35372603e5704dd0c6e39931f3bbda79c65533bd5ba57d5dc9c1a98cbb38c796

1 Input
2 Outputs
  • 35372603e5704dd0c6e39931f3bbda79c65533bd5ba57d5dc9c1a98cbb38c796:0
  • value  11117352
    address  3GhX1a88D1ydUvyMUWkd3khn3JKQUFWjgq
  • 35372603e5704dd0c6e39931f3bbda79c65533bd5ba57d5dc9c1a98cbb38c796:1
  • value  351175512
    address  3AH5Yp8KXh4QBos3TgZ5uA79ozkX5zAxG9